Meeting notes — asset return review. The leased Corvair-series laptops from Pellbrook Systems are scheduled for return next week. Records team: log each serial number, lease tag, and wipe certificate in the returns ledger before the units are boxed. Incomplete records hold the shipment. Boxes are staged in Room 112 until pick-up. The confidential courier hand-over instruction is appended directly below.

drop instructions, yafog-yawip: the quenmir olidor courier leaves the julox tamion keliel ledger at gate 5283 under passcode 336825

Pinning policy, Driftspar platform. All production dependencies are pinned to exact versions; transitive deps locked via the Cobblewright resolver. Upgrades flow through a staging soak of fixed duration before promotion, with automatic rollback on integrity-hash mismatch. Unpinned ranges are permitted only in scratch repos. Security-relevant packages get a shorter soak but mandatory dual sign-off. Enforcement thresholds — soak hours, max dependency age, and hash-check cadence — are configured here.

constants for bagag-fawip:
BUDGETS = {
    "wenius": 400,
    "brieth": 224,
    "rusath": 783,
    "eliys": 187,
    "aldax": 737,
    "ralion": 818,
    "istius": 153,
}

Onboarding note for the Ledgerpane admin table: bulk edits are applied through the batcher service, not directly against the database. Select rows, choose an action, and the batcher stages changes in a pending set you can review before commit. Edits over 500 rows require a second approver — this is enforced server-side, so don't try to chunk around it. To run the batcher locally you need the staging write credential, which goes in your .env as the next line.

secret setting of bahip-kagag: RELAY_SECRET3=c83

Escalation for the Marrow Bay tide-table widget: if TideScope data lags more than 20 minutes, first restart the ingest worker. If stale data persists after two restarts, escalate to the Coastal Data rotation — do not silently retry overnight. Document timestamps in the incident channel. For escalation beyond the rotation, contact the service owner.

escalation mailbox, bafog-fafog: ulador@paliqlabs.internal